From 95b1be66d4c16b1b05b761c1771df229ac0e539c Mon Sep 17 00:00:00 2001 From: Sean Hall Date: Fri, 31 Dec 2021 18:20:50 -0600 Subject: Try to get more helpful test failure messages. --- .../BaseBootstrapperApplicationFactoryFixture.cs | 3 ++- .../burn/test/WixToolsetTest.Mba.Core/WixToolsetTest.Mba.Core.csproj | 5 +++++ src/api/wix/test/WixToolsetTest.Data/SerializeFixture.cs | 3 ++- src/api/wix/test/WixToolsetTest.Data/WixToolsetTest.Data.csproj | 5 +++++ 4 files changed, 14 insertions(+), 2 deletions(-) (limited to 'src/api') diff --git a/src/api/burn/test/WixToolsetTest.Mba.Core/BaseBootstrapperApplicationFactoryFixture.cs b/src/api/burn/test/WixToolsetTest.Mba.Core/BaseBootstrapperApplicationFactoryFixture.cs index 8705ed13..39a92024 100644 --- a/src/api/burn/test/WixToolsetTest.Mba.Core/BaseBootstrapperApplicationFactoryFixture.cs +++ b/src/api/burn/test/WixToolsetTest.Mba.Core/BaseBootstrapperApplicationFactoryFixture.cs @@ -5,6 +5,7 @@ namespace WixToolsetTest.Mba.Core using System; using System.Collections.Generic; using System.Runtime.InteropServices; + using WixBuildTools.TestSupport; using WixToolset.Mba.Core; using Xunit; @@ -45,7 +46,7 @@ namespace WixToolsetTest.Mba.Core Assert.Equal(baFactory.BA.Command.Display, command.display); var mbaCommand = baFactory.BA.Command.ParseCommandLine(); - Assert.Equal(mbaCommand.UnknownCommandLineArgs, new string[] { "this", "is a", "test" }); + WixAssert.CompareLineByLine(mbaCommand.UnknownCommandLineArgs, new string[] { "this", "is a", "test" }); Assert.Equal(mbaCommand.Variables, new KeyValuePair[] { new KeyValuePair("VariableA", "AVariable"), diff --git a/src/api/burn/test/WixToolsetTest.Mba.Core/WixToolsetTest.Mba.Core.csproj b/src/api/burn/test/WixToolsetTest.Mba.Core/WixToolsetTest.Mba.Core.csproj index af3a09b0..39d4def3 100644 --- a/src/api/burn/test/WixToolsetTest.Mba.Core/WixToolsetTest.Mba.Core.csproj +++ b/src/api/burn/test/WixToolsetTest.Mba.Core/WixToolsetTest.Mba.Core.csproj @@ -14,6 +14,11 @@ + + + + + diff --git a/src/api/wix/test/WixToolsetTest.Data/SerializeFixture.cs b/src/api/wix/test/WixToolsetTest.Data/SerializeFixture.cs index 8a65c2d4..cd485fd2 100644 --- a/src/api/wix/test/WixToolsetTest.Data/SerializeFixture.cs +++ b/src/api/wix/test/WixToolsetTest.Data/SerializeFixture.cs @@ -5,6 +5,7 @@ namespace WixToolsetTest.Data using System; using System.IO; using System.Linq; + using WixBuildTools.TestSupport; using WixToolset.Data; using WixToolset.Data.Bind; using WixToolset.Data.Symbols; @@ -375,7 +376,7 @@ namespace WixToolsetTest.Data var loc = loaded.Localizations.Single(); Assert.Equal(65001, loc.Codepage); Assert.Empty(loc.Culture); - Assert.Equal(new[] + WixAssert.CompareLineByLine(new[] { "TestVar1/TestValue1/False", "TestVar2/TestValue2/True", diff --git a/src/api/wix/test/WixToolsetTest.Data/WixToolsetTest.Data.csproj b/src/api/wix/test/WixToolsetTest.Data/WixToolsetTest.Data.csproj index f6e10488..36220fb7 100644 --- a/src/api/wix/test/WixToolsetTest.Data/WixToolsetTest.Data.csproj +++ b/src/api/wix/test/WixToolsetTest.Data/WixToolsetTest.Data.csproj @@ -12,6 +12,11 @@ + + + + + -- cgit v1.2.3-55-g6feb